Daily Current Affairs / Indian Navy to Commission Survey Vessel ‘Ikshak’
Category : Defense Published on: November 07 2025
The Indian Navy will commission its third Survey Vessel (Large) class ship, ‘Ikshak’ at the Kochi Naval Base. Built by Garden Reach Shipbuilders & Engineers (GRSE), Kolkata, with over 80% indigenous content, the ship symbolizes the success of Aatmanirbhar Bharat. Named from the Sanskrit word meaning “guide,” Ikshak is equipped with modern hydrographic tools like AUVs, ROVs, and multi-beam echo sounders. It will conduct coastal and deep-sea surveys, enhancing maritime navigation and safety. The ship will operate under Southern Naval Command to strengthen India’s maritime capabilities.
